When It’s Time to Get Your Air Conditioning Repaired
Is the level of comfort in your house falling short of what you would like it to be? There are other, more subtle issues that, if neglected, might lead to more severe repairs or the need for an early replacement of your ac system. While a unit that won’t switch on is a clear indication that you require repairs, there are other, less obvious issues. If you recognize with the more subtle indications of a issue with your air conditioning, you will be able to contact a professional service professional sooner rather than later.
If any of the following use, one of our Kansas AC repair experts recommends that you give us a call:
- You are sustaining an increase in the amount of money required to spend for your monthly utility expenses: Inefficient operation of your air conditioning unit can be triggered by a number of various problems, including dripping ductwork, an internal malfunction, or a defective thermostat. This means that it needs to work more difficult to keep your residential or commercial property cool, which will lead to a considerable increase in the quantity that you pay in energy expenses.
- You just observe hot air coming out of your vents: First things first, make certain you haven’t inadvertently set the thermostat to the inaccurate temperature by checking it. If that is not the case, then you most likely have a issue on the inside of your a/c unit, and you must get it inspected by a professional.
- You are seeing a greater humidity level at your home: Even though this is not the main function of your air conditioning system, it is accountable for managing the humidity level within your home or business building. Higher humidity suggests that there is an excess of moisture in the air, which can lead to the development of mold and mildew in addition to making the air feel warm and sticky. It is necessary that you get this matter fixed as rapidly as humanly practical, especially for the sake of your safety.
- The airflow in your system is inadequate: Regrettably, there are a wide array of factors that can lead to inadequate airflow. We will require to perform a detailed evaluation in order to find out whether the issue is the result of a blocked air filter, an concern with the blower, frozen evaporator coils, dripping ductwork, or blocked duct.
- You observe that there is a considerable amount of wetness in the location around your unit: Condensation is a natural event, nevertheless it should not be present in extreme amounts. It is possible that you have a leaking refrigerant or a clogged up drain tube if you observe any excess wetness or pooling water in the area.
- Weird Noises from Your Unit: It is to be expected for an ac system to develop some background sound while it is running. On the other hand, if it begins making audible screeching, squealing, grinding, groaning, or scraping sounds, this is an obvious sign that something needs to be repaired.
- It appears that there is a issue with your thermostat: It’s possible that the thermostat is the source of the problems you’re having with your a/c. If you have hot and cold areas around your home, your system won’t turn off, or it won’t start, it could be because of a issue with the thermostat. If your unit won’t begin, it might also be since it will not shut down.
- Foul odors are coming from your unit: There may be a issue with your air conditioner if you smell anything burning or a musty odor. These smells can be caused by a range of elements, consisting of mold development and charred electrical wiring.
- Your unit turns often between the following states: When the temperature level inside your home reaches the level that you have actually chosen on the thermostat, air conditioning unit are set to shut off immediately. Regardless of this, it will continue to cycle even when there is something incorrect with it.

The HVAC System Is Making Weird Noises
There are a few sounds that need to not be heard originating from air conditioning unit even though they do not operate in full silence. These noises might be anything from a banging to a screeching to a grinding to a clicking noise. These particular sounds generally show that there is a problem within the cooling system that has to be repaired by a specialist of in Linn County.
Sounds that are Weird and Different Coming From Your AC The following need to be consisted of:
- Banging: The issue is generally the compressor in an ac system that is making a banging noise. This part of the air conditioning unit is accountable for delivering refrigerant to the different other parts of the system in order to get rid of excess heat from your home. Compressor components may relax as the air conditioning system ages. This sound is caused by the parts walking around and rattling and crashing one another.
- Screeching: A broken blower fan motor within the air conditioning system might produce a sound similar to screeching or screeching if the motor is working improperly. Usually, a defective fan belt or damaged bearings in the motor are to blame for this noise. Shut off the a/c right now and connect with a professional for repairs whenever you hear a shrieking sound.
- Grinding: The sound of something grinding is never a excellent indication to hear originating from any kind of mechanical object. Pistons inside the compressor might have worn, which may lead to this grinding sound emanating from the AC. When a compressor’s pistons become worn, it often indicates that the compressor itself has to be replaced. The complete AC unit could need to be changed depending on the design of air conditioning and how old it is.
- Clicking: It is really typical for an air conditioning unit to make a clicking noise when it at first turns on. If you hear clicking throughout the whole duration of the cooling cycle, then there is a issue with the clicking. These clicks are the outcome of a thermostat that is not working appropriately.
